Catalog Number: 10-1900-xx

Description: Chemical Phosphorylation Reagent

2-[2-(4,4'-Dimethoxytrityloxy)ethylsulfonyl]ethyl-(2-cyanoethyl)-
(N,N-diisopropyl)-phosphoramidite
Formula: C34H45N2O7PSM.W.: 656.77F.W.: 79.98

Diluent: Anhydrous Acetonitrile
Add fresh diluent to product vial to recommended concentration and swirl vial occasionally over several minutes until product is completely dissolved. (Some oils may require between 5 and 10 minutes.) Use care to maintain anhydrous conditions. In case of transfer to alternate vial type, ensure recipient vial has been pre-dried. Coupling: No changes needed from standard method recommended by synthesizer manufacturer.
Deprotection: No changes needed from standard method recommended by synthesizer manufacturer. Note: The DMT-group is removed during the ammonium hydroxide deprotection and thus is not available for poly-pak purification. Deprotection Detail
Storage: Refrigerated storage, maximum of 2-8 °C, dry
Stability in Solution: 2-3 days

The DMT-group is removed during the ammonium hydroxide deprotection and thus is not available for poly-pak purification

The user may remove the DMT during synthesis to check coupling efficiency.

This reagent can be used to create the 3Õ-phosphate by adding it as the first addition to the support. After ammonia deprotection the oligo will have the 3'-phosphate attached to the 2nd base added during synthesis-Both the support base and the CPR are cleaved
